
Indian shuttler Aakarshi Kashyap defeated Chinese Taipei's Lee Yu-Hsuan 21-10, 21-15 in the qualifiers to enter the women's singles main draw at the German Open Super 300 badminton tournament. Kashyap will next face another Chinese Taipei player, Huang Yu-Hsun. Other Indian participants include veteran Kidambi Srikanth and World Junior Championships silver medallist Tanvi Sharma in the USD 250,000 event held in Mülheim an der Ruhr.
